Dr. Jin Han Kwon is a leading innovator in the field of wearable ionotronics and deformable sensory platforms. His research focuses on developing advanced multimodal ionoskins—flexible, stimuli-responsive materials that can independently detect and differentiate external inputs such as temperature and mechanical strain without signal crosstalk. His most-cited work, "Multimodal Wearable Ionoskins Enabling Independent Recognition of External Stimuli Without Crosstalk" (2023, 26 citations), introduces a groundbreaking ionotronic thermo-mechano-multimodal response sensor that overcomes a critical limitation in soft electronics: the inability to decouple simultaneous stimuli. This achievement has significant implications for prosthetics, human-machine interfaces, and healthcare monitoring, where precise, interference-free sensing is essential.
